Creating a table in Design view allows users to define the structure of the table, including field names, data types, and properties, offering greater control and precision. In contrast, Datasheet view presents a more spreadsheet-like interface where users can input data directly without specifying the underlying structure first. Design view is ideal for establishing the framework of a database, while Datasheet view is suited for data entry and quick edits.

Can you enter data in design view in ms access?

No. Design view is for creating the table and manipulating the fields and the structure of the fields and the table. It is not for entering data. To do that you can go to datasheet view or use a form.


Differwnce between datasheet and design view?

A datasheet view displays data in a tabular format, showing records and fields in rows and columns, making it easy to view and edit data entries. In contrast, a design view is used for creating and modifying the structure of a database object, such as tables, queries, or forms, allowing users to define field types, properties, and relationships. Essentially, the datasheet view is focused on data management, while the design view focuses on database structure and design.

What are the 2 views of table in access?

In Microsoft Access, tables can be viewed in two primary ways: Datasheet View and Design View. Datasheet View displays the data in a spreadsheet-like format, allowing users to easily view, enter, and edit records. Design View, on the other hand, provides a structure-oriented format where users can define or modify the table's fields, data types, and other properties. These views cater to different tasks, making data management more efficient.

What are the different techniques used in creating an inlay design?

Different techniques used in creating an inlay design include cutting out a cavity in the base material and fitting inlays of contrasting materials, using a router or chisel to create recesses for inlays, and using adhesives to secure the inlay pieces in place. Additionally, artists may use techniques such as sand shading, engraving, and carving to enhance the design of the inlay.
